Key codes 418/419 are KEY_ZOOMIN and KEY_ZOOMOUT. We don't have any hwdb
keymaps for ASUS which set those, but it applies to the USB keyboard:

I tracked down the root cause to the location service reacting to
changes to the PrimaryConnection property of
org.freedesktop.NetworkManager by reaching out to all devices associated
with the primary connection, and querying their properties, both for
wifi devices and cross-referencing to Ofono

This reminds me of https://bugzilla.gnome.org/show_bug.cgi?id=680911:
NetworkManager treats several different causes of Wi-Fi disconnection as
if they are the fault of an incorrect password.
